What's the use of SLR monopod? What's the difference with a tripod?

First, the roles are different

1, monopod: It provides a considerable degree of portability and flexibility, and at the same time slows down the speed of the safety shutter by about 3 gears.

2. tripod: a bracket used to stabilize the camera to achieve some photographic effects. The positioning of tripod is very important.

Second, the characteristics are different.

1, monopod: it is a stable camera. Unlike tripods, monopods are not suitable for long exposure.

2. tripod: when you want to shoot the night scene or the surging trajectory, you need a longer exposure time. At this time, if you want the camera not to shake, you need the help of a tripod.

Third, the advantages are different.

1, monopod: shooting wild animals, mountaineering and other occasions that require high portability, some monopods also have the function of trekking poles, sports competitions, concerts, news reports and other occasions where space is limited and there is no tripod position.

2, tripod: need to capture the moment, but also need a certain degree of stability to prevent hand jitter, high flexibility requirements.
